Skin grafting devices are widely used in procedures such as treating skin injuries, burn injuries, chronic wounds, skin infections and reconstructive surgeries. Skin grafting involves removing a portion of healthy skin from an uninjured site of the body known as the donor site, and transplanting it to the injured area of the body known as the recipient site. Some of the key products in the skin grafting device market include dermatomes, skin graft blades, and skin graft meshers and fabric. Dermatomes are used to shave off thin layers of skin from the donor site, to be used as skin grafts. Skin graft blades and meshers are used for sizing and meshing of the harvested skin for use at the recipient site. Fabric based skin grafts are also used commonly for covering large wound areas.

The skin grafting device market is estimated to witness high growth owing to increasing prevalence of skin diseases and chronic wounds worldwide. As per the American Society of Plastic Surgeons, around 1.5 million skin grafting procedures are performed annually in the US alone for treating severe burns and chronic wounds. Moreover, rising number of accidents, trauma cases and burn injuries is also expected to drive the demand for skin grafting devices over the forecast period. One of the major drivers fueling growth of the market is growing geriatric population. According to Wound Care Centers, 60% of all chronic wounds occur in people aged 65 and older. Aged skin is more prone to injuries and takes longer to heal. This presents a vast untapped market potential for skin grafting device manufacturers to leverage. However, market growth may be hindered by high costs associated with skin grafting procedures and scarce availability of skin donors.
